Health Benefits

Goji berries are known for their high antioxidant content, which can help protect cells from oxidative stress and support overall health.
Greek yogurt provides a good source of protein and probiotics, promoting gut health and aiding in digestion.

How to Prepare & Consume

Blend goji berries, Greek yogurt, and your choice of liquid (water or almond milk) until smooth. Serve chilled.

Smart Selection & Storage

How to Select

Choose goji berries that are bright in color and plump. For Greek yogurt, look for low-fat or non-fat options without added sugars.

How to Store

Store goji berries in a cool, dry place. Greek yogurt should be refrigerated and consumed before the expiration date.

Myths vs Realities

MythGoji berries are a miracle food that can cure all diseases.
RealityWhile goji berries are nutritious, they are not a cure-all and should be part of a balanced diet.
MythGreek yogurt is always high in sugar.
RealitySugar content varies; choose unsweetened varieties for a healthier option.
MythSmoothies are always healthy.
RealitySmoothies can be high in calories and sugar if not made with care; always check ingredients.

Healthy Recipes

Goji Berry Greek Yogurt Parfait

Layered with granola and fresh fruits, this parfait is a delightful way to enjoy a nutritious breakfast or snack.

Ingredients
  • 1 cup Sugar-Free Goji Berry Greek Yogurt Smoothie
  • 1/2 cup granola
  • 1/2 cup mixed berries
  • 1 tablespoon honey (optional)
Instructions
  1. 1. In a glass, layer half of the granola at the bottom.
  2. 2. Add half of the Sugar-Free Goji Berry Greek Yogurt Smoothie on top.
  3. 3. Layer with mixed berries and repeat the process, finishing with a drizzle of honey if desired.

Goji Berry Overnight Oats

These overnight oats infused with goji berry yogurt are a quick and healthy breakfast option.

Ingredients
  • 1/2 cup rolled oats
  • 1 cup Sugar-Free Goji Berry Greek Yogurt Smoothie
  • 1/2 cup almond milk
  • 1 tablespoon flaxseeds
Instructions
  1. 1. In a jar, combine rolled oats, Sugar-Free Goji Berry Greek Yogurt Smoothie, almond milk, and flaxseeds.
  2. 2. Stir well and seal the jar.
  3. 3. Refrigerate overnight and enjoy in the morning.

Goji Berry Smoothie Muffins

These healthy muffins are infused with goji berry yogurt, making them a perfect grab-and-go snack.

Ingredients
  • 1 1/2 cups whole wheat flour
  • 1 cup Sugar-Free Goji Berry Greek Yogurt Smoothie
  • 1/2 cup applesauce
  • 1/4 cup honey
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
Instructions
  1. 1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a muffin tin.
  2. 2. In a bowl, mix whole wheat flour, baking soda, and a pinch of salt.
  3. 3. In another bowl, combine the Sugar-Free Goji Berry Greek Yogurt Smoothie, applesauce, and honey, then mix with the dry ingredients.
  4. 4. Pour the batter into the muffin tin and bake for 20-25 minutes.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

What are the health benefits of goji berries?

Goji berries are rich in antioxidants, vitamins, and minerals, which can help boost the immune system and improve skin health.

Is Greek yogurt good for digestion?

Yes, Greek yogurt contains probiotics that can aid in digestion and promote gut health.

Can I use frozen goji berries in this smoothie?

Yes, frozen goji berries can be used and will create a thicker texture.

How many calories are in this smoothie?

This smoothie contains approximately 85 calories per serving.

Is this smoothie suitable for weight loss?

Yes, it is low in calories and high in protein, making it a great option for weight loss.

Can I add other fruits to this smoothie?

Absolutely! You can add bananas, berries, or any fruit of your choice.

How long can I store this smoothie?

It is best consumed fresh, but can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 24 hours.

Is this smoothie vegan?

If you use a plant-based yogurt, it can be made vegan.
